SSD upgrade only 2x link width

Hi I was increasing the space on my late 2013 15” rMBP using the long Sintech adapter and a Samsung 970 Evo (Samsung MZ-V7E1T0BW 970 EVO 1 TB V-NAND M.2 PCI Express) but the link width is only showing as x2 and it seems to be running slow.

Block Image

Block Image

I tried SMC reset, format & reinstall Mojave, take it out and make sure its sitting in the adapter and connector right but still no luck.

Does anyone have any suggestions?

Chosen Solution

If anyone has the same problem. Make sure theres no pins exposed before the gold pins. The tape to cover those pins had shifted on mine exposing the pins. I put a small piece of Kapton tape on the front to cover all the pins and now it works perfectly.

I just upgraded my 2017 MacBook Air 128GB SSD with the Samsung 970 EVO 1 TB SSD. Installation seemed just fine. Performance was weird. The NVMe specs in the “About this Mac” show “x2” links versus “x4” links in my wife’s identical MacBook Air 128 GB laptop (unmodified). Blackmagic shows her Apple SSD “Read” performance is twice my EVO performance — seemed to correlate with the link numbers. So I searched and found your similar finding. Not sure I understood the possible fix, however.

I didn’t understand the description of the piece of tape that covers some pins? All pins in both my long Sintech Adapter Card and the EVO SSD are gold and I got confused about “before the gold pins”.
